自然语言处理如何成为机器学习领域的一部分?

自然语言处理(NLP)是机器学习领域的一个重要分支,它致力于使计算机能够理解、解释和生成人类语言。NLP技术包括语言识别、语音合成、机器翻译等。

自然语言处理(Natural Language Processing,简称NLP)是机器学习人工智能领域的一个重要分支,它致力于使计算机能够理解、解释和生成人类语言,NLP结合了计算机科学、语言学和统计学等多个学科的知识,以实现与人类语言的有效交互。

nlp属于机器学习_什么是自然语言处理
(图片来源网络,侵删)

自然语言处理的定义

自然语言处理是指让机器理解和回应用自然语言表达的信息,这包括文本和语音数据,以及对这些数据的自动处理和分析,NLP的目标是让机器能像人类一样理解语言的多样性和复杂性。

自然语言处理的应用范围

NLP技术被广泛应用于多个领域,包括但不限于:

机器翻译:将一种语言翻译成另一种语言。

nlp属于机器学习_什么是自然语言处理
(图片来源网络,侵删)

情感分析:识别文本中的情感倾向,如积极或消极。

信息提取:从非结构化文本中提取结构化信息。

文本分类:将文本文档归类到预定义的类别中。

语音识别:将语音转换成文本。

自动问答系统:回答用户提出的问题。

nlp属于机器学习_什么是自然语言处理
(图片来源网络,侵删)

聊天机器人:模拟人类对话的自动化系统。

自然语言处理的技术手段

NLP涉及多种技术,以下是一些核心组成部分:

1、词法分析:识别文本中的单词和标点符号。

2、句法分析:确定单词之间的语法关系。

3、语义分析:理解句子的意义。

4、实体识别:识别文本中的命名实体,如人名、地点、组织等。

5、情感分析:评估文本表达的情绪倾向。

6、机器翻译:自动将一种语言翻译成另一种语言。

7、语音处理:包括语音识别和语音合成。

自然语言处理的挑战

尽管NLP取得了显著进展,但仍面临许多挑战:

歧义性:自然语言充满了歧义,相同的词语在不同的语境下可能有不同的意义。

多语言问题:不同语言有不同的语法规则和表达习惯,跨语言处理复杂性高。

讽刺和幽默:机器很难理解人类的讽刺和幽默。

文化差异:文化背景对语言理解和表达有深刻影响。

自然语言处理与机器学习的关系

NLP的许多技术和方法都基于机器学习,尤其是深度学习,机器学习模型可以从大量标注数据中学习语言模式,并用于预测和分类任务,循环神经网络(RNNs)和变压器模型(Transformers)在NLP中广泛用于序列数据处理。

相关表格

NLP技术 描述 应用场景
词法分析 分析文本以识别单词和标点 搜索引擎、文本编辑器
句法分析 确定单词间的语法关系 语法检查、自动摘要
语义分析 理解句子的含义 自动问答系统、推荐系统
实体识别 识别文本中的特定实体 信息抽取、知识图谱构建
情感分析 评估情绪倾向 市场研究、公共意见监测
机器翻译 自动翻译语言 国际化应用、跨文化交流
语音处理 语音到文本或文本到语音转换 虚拟助手、无障碍服务

相关问题与解答

Q1: 自然语言处理能否完全取代人工翻译?

A1: 目前,尽管机器翻译技术已经相当先进,但自然语言处理还不能完全取代人工翻译,机器翻译在处理常规文本时表现良好,但在处理专业性强、文化背景深厚或含有丰富情感色彩的文本时,仍需要人工翻译的细致调整和理解。

Q2: 未来自然语言处理的发展趋势是什么?

A2: 自然语言处理的未来发展趋势包括更加深入地整合深度学习技术,提高模型的泛化能力和对复杂语境的理解;增强跨语言和跨文化的处理能力;以及提升对讽刺、幽默和非文字性线索(如表情和语调)的识别和理解,随着计算能力的提升和算法的优化,实时NLP应用将变得更加广泛和高效。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/911167.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希新媒体运营
上一篇 2024-08-22 08:01
下一篇 2024-08-22 08:03

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入